Strengthening Building Management System Protection : Optimal Approaches for a Digital Globe
As facilities become increasingly integrated , the vulnerability of Building Management Systems (BMS) to intrusions grows dramatically . Protecting these crucial systems requires a layered methodology focused on both onsite and online defenses. Key recommendations include regularly updating software and patching identified system vulnerabilities, implementing robust network separation to limit the impact of potential incidents, and employing multi-factor authorization for all profiles . Furthermore, creating a thorough incident response plan , coupled with regular security audits and employee awareness programs, are vital to maintain a strong security stance. Aspects should also involve scrutinizing third-party contractor access and ensuring compliance with relevant industry regulations .

A Risks of Vulnerable Control System Platforms and How to Reduce Such Issues
With the widespread use of lithium-ion batteries in various applications, a security of Battery Management System infrastructure becomes critical . Unsecured BMS systems can present serious risks – spanning malicious manipulation to actual harm of battery packs and, potentially, dangerous events . Unauthorized individuals could manipulate charging profiles, operating conditions, or even shut down the entire system. To secure against these weaknesses , it's crucial to adopt robust security measures such as multi-factor verification , regular software updates , network segmentation , and intrusion detection systems . Moreover, conducting frequent security audits can proactively uncover and address potential deficiencies before they're exploited by malicious actors. In conclusion, a layered approach to BMS security is essential for ensuring the safety and longevity of battery-powered devices .
BMS Digital Security Checklist: Vital Procedures for Safe Operation
To ensure a secure Battery Management System (BMS) operation, a comprehensive digital safety checklist is vitally important. This checklist should cover several key areas – including regular software updates to fix vulnerabilities, robust access controls limiting who can modify system parameters, and diligent monitoring for any anomalous behavior that could indicate a security compromise . Furthermore, proper encryption of data both at rest and in transit is needed , along with strict adherence to established cybersecurity protocols. Don't overlook regular vulnerability scans and penetration testing performed by qualified professionals to proactively identify and address potential risks before they can be exploited, ensuring the ongoing integrity of your BMS.
